Cardiogen (Ala-Glu-Asp-Arg) is a synthetic tetrapeptide bioregulator developed by Professor Vladimir Khavinson at the Saint Petersburg Institute of Bioregulation and Gerontology. It belongs to the Khavinson class of short peptide bioregulators — ultrashort sequences (3-4 amino acids) designed to interact with specific DNA promoter regions and modulate gene expression in target tissues.

Mecanismo de Acción
3 vías biológicas distintas a través de las cuales opera este péptido.
GATA4/Nkx2.5 Transcription Factor Activation
Cardiogen directly upregulates GATA4 and Nkx2.5 — the master transcription factors governing cardiomyocyte identity, differentiation, and cardiac-specific gene expression programs.
- GATA4 drives expression of cardiac structural proteins (MHC, troponins, connexins)
- Nkx2.5 is essential for cardiac progenitor cell commitment and chamber formation
- Combined upregulation promotes functional cardiomyocyte differentiation from progenitor cells
Khavinson et al. (2011) PMID: 22462050
Epigenetic DNA-Peptide Interaction
Cardiogen penetrates cell nuclei and binds directly to specific DNA promoter sequences, modifying histone acetylation patterns and chromatin accessibility at cardiac gene loci.
- Tetrapeptide physically interacts with double-stranded DNA at complementary nucleotide sequences
- Induces localized histone acetylation — opening chromatin for transcription factor access
- Mechanism is organ-specific: Cardiogen preferentially binds cardiac gene promoters
Fedoreyeva et al. (2017) PMID: 29223156
Cytoprotective & Anti-Apoptotic Signaling
Cardiogen upregulates cytoprotective genes including heat shock proteins and anti-apoptotic factors, enhancing cardiomyocyte survival under ischemic and oxidative stress.
- HSP70 induction provides protein folding protection during cellular stress
- Bcl-2 upregulation shifts the apoptotic balance toward cell survival
- Antioxidant enzyme expression (SOD, catalase) reduces mitochondrial ROS damage
Khavinson (2016) Biology Bulletin Reviews; Veniaminov et al. (2015)

Cómo Funciona Cardiogen
Cardiogen is a synthetic tetrapeptide bioregulator designed to target cardiac tissue. It penetrates cell membranes and interacts with DNA regulatory regions to modulate transcription of genes involved in cardiomyocyte metabolism, cellular stress responses, and myocardial repair. Studies show it influences the expression of genes related to heat-shock protein production, cell-cycle regulation, and age-related changes in cardiac gene expression profiles. It may promote cardiomyocyte survival and functional recovery after ischemic insult.
